Sorghum is a drought-resistant cereal widely used for human food, traditional porridge, flour milling, beverages, and animal feed.
It is highly valued for its nutritional benefits, gluten-free nature, and suitability for both local and export markets.

Quality & Specifications:
• Origin: Tanzania
• Type: Sorghum grains
• Color: White, red, or brown (depending on variety)
• Purity: ≥ 99%
• Moisture Content: ≤ 13%
• Free from mold, pests, and contaminants
